Copyright © www.batteriestransport.org 130 2.3.2.1 WASTE LITHIUM ION CELLS & BATTERIES (including lithium ion polymer cells and batteries) Fully regulated_P903 UN 3480 WASTE Applies to: Waste Lithium ion cells with a Watt-hour rating in excess of 20 Wh/cell Waste Lithium ion batteries with a Watt-hour rating in excess of 100 Wh/battery Note: waste cells and batteries transported as new one. UN No., Proper Shipping Name UN 3480, LITHIUM ION BATTERIES Class 9 Packing Group n/a Hazard Label • Labels must be in the form of a square set at an angle of 45° (diamond-shaped) with minimum dimensions of 100 mm by 100 mm; except for air transport mode, labels dimensions may be reduced in the case of packages of such dimensions that they can only bear smaller labels. • They must have a line 5 mm inside the edge and running parallel with it. Prerequisite • Cells must meet the General Requirements Specific Requirements • Each battery incorporates a safety venting device or is designed to preclude a violent rupture under normal conditions of carriage; • Each battery is equipped with an effective means of preventing external short circuits • Each battery containing cells or series of cells connected in parallel must be equipped with an effective means, as necessary, to prevent dangerous reverse current flow (e.g. diodes, fuses). • Batteries manufactured after 31 December 2011 must be marked with the Wh rating on the outside case. Transport mode ADR IMDG IATA Waste batteries and batteries being shipped for recycling or disposal are prohibited from air transport unless approved by the appropriate national authority of the State of Origin and the State of the Operator. P903 P903 Packing instructions • Cells and batteries must be protected against short circuit, including protection against contact with conductive materials within the same packaging which could cause a short circuit. • Cells and batteries must be packed so that are protected against damage caused by the movement or placement of cells and batteries within the packaging • Use only approved packaging conforming to Packing Group II performance level.
